Simon Bott is an actor, singer, and dancer who has been performing since 2021. In his time he has played several prominent roles such as "Frankincense Pontipee" in the award-winning Morgan High School production of "Seven Brides for Seven Brothers." This role earned him a nomination for "best cameo" which allowed him to perform at the Eccle's Theater in Salt Lake City. Simon has also been singing for years. As part of the 2022 Utah High School Honor Choir, he sang at Abravanel Hall in Salt Lake City.
